If you are looking to obtain a small loan for purchasing a treadmill or exercise equipment, there are a few options available to consider. One option is to apply for a personal loan from a bank or credit union. Personal loans can be used for a variety of purposes, including buying exercise equipment.
Another option is to look into financing options offered by retailers. Many stores that sell treadmills and exercise equipment offer financing plans with low or no interest rates for a certain period of time. This can be a convenient way to spread out the cost of the equipment over time.
Alternatively, you could also consider using a credit card to make the purchase. Some credit cards offer rewards or cash back for certain types of purchases, including fitness equipment. Just be sure to pay off the balance in full each month to avoid accruing interest.
Before taking out a loan or financing a purchase, it's important to carefully consider your budget and weigh the costs and benefits of each option. Make sure to shop around and compare offers to find the best deal for your needs.
What is the loan approval process like for small loans?
The loan approval process for small loans typically involves the following steps:
- Application: The borrower completes an application form providing personal and financial information, such as income, employment status, credit score, and loan amount requested.
- Credit check: The lender evaluates the borrower's credit history to assess the level of risk involved in lending to them.
- Income verification: The lender may request proof of income, such as pay stubs or bank statements, to ensure the borrower has the means to repay the loan.
- Collateral evaluation (if applicable): If the loan requires collateral, such as a car or home, the lender will assess the value of the asset.
- Approval decision: Based on the information provided, the lender will make a decision on whether to approve the loan or not. This decision is typically based on the borrower's creditworthiness and ability to repay.
- Loan terms: If the loan is approved, the borrower will be provided with the loan terms, including the interest rate, repayment schedule, and any fees associated with the loan.
- Funding: Once the borrower accepts the loan terms, the funds will be disbursed to their account.
Overall, the loan approval process for small loans is usually quicker and less stringent compared to larger loans, as the loan amounts are lower and the risk to the lender is generally lower.
How to apply for a small loan online?
Applying for a small loan online is a relatively simple process. Here are the general steps to follow:
- Research and compare online lenders: Look for reputable lenders that offer small loans online and compare their interest rates, loan terms, and eligibility requirements.
- Pre-qualify: Many online lenders offer pre-qualification tools that allow you to check your eligibility and potential loan terms without impacting your credit score. Use this tool to see if you meet the lender's requirements.
- Gather required documents: To apply for a small loan online, you will need to provide documents such as proof of income, identification, and bank statements. Make sure you have these documents ready before starting the application process.
- Fill out the online application: Once you've chosen a lender, visit their website and fill out the online application form. Be sure to provide accurate and up-to-date information to streamline the approval process.
- Review and e-sign the loan agreement: After submitting your application, the lender will review your information and may request additional documents. Once approved, carefully review the loan agreement terms and e-sign the document to accept the loan offer.
- Receive funds: After signing the loan agreement, the lender will typically deposit the funds directly into your bank account within a few business days.
- Repay the loan: Make timely payments according to the loan agreement terms to avoid late fees or negative effects on your credit score.
It's important to do thorough research and comparison shopping before applying for a small loan online to ensure you are getting the best terms and rates for your financial situation. Additionally, be cautious of scams and only apply with reputable lenders.
What is the difference between a secured and unsecured loan?
The main difference between a secured and unsecured loan is the presence of collateral.
- Secured Loan:
- A secured loan is backed by collateral, such as a car or a house.
- If the borrower fails to repay the loan, the lender can take possession of the collateral to recoup their losses.
- Secured loans typically have lower interest rates and higher borrowing limits because the collateral reduces the lender's risk.
- Unsecured Loan:
- An unsecured loan is not backed by any collateral.
- Lenders rely solely on the borrower's creditworthiness to determine whether to approve the loan.
- Unsecured loans generally have higher interest rates and lower borrowing limits compared to secured loans because they pose a higher risk to the lender.
Overall, secured loans are considered less risky for lenders and more beneficial for borrowers in terms of lower interest rates and higher borrowing limits. On the other hand, unsecured loans are easier to obtain but may come with higher costs due to the lack of collateral.
How to compare interest rates from different lenders?
To compare interest rates from different lenders, follow these steps:
- Obtain quotes: Request quotes or interest rate offers from multiple lenders. This can be done by filling out online forms, contacting lenders directly, or working with a mortgage broker who can provide quotes from several lenders.
- Compare APR: The Annual Percentage Rate (APR) takes into account not only the interest rate, but also any additional fees and costs associated with the loan. Comparing APRs can give you a more accurate picture of the overall cost of the loan.
- Consider loan terms: In addition to the interest rate, consider the terms of the loan, such as the length of the loan (e.g. 15 or 30 years), whether it has a fixed or adjustable rate, and any prepayment penalties.
- Evaluate additional features: Some loans may offer additional features or benefits, such as the ability to make extra payments without penalties, or assistance programs for first-time homebuyers. Consider these additional features when comparing lenders.
- Get pre-approved: Once you have narrowed down your options, consider getting pre-approved for a loan from each lender. This can give you a better idea of the interest rate you qualify for and help you make a final decision.
- Consult with a financial advisor: If you are having trouble comparing interest rates or understanding the terms of different loans, consider consulting with a financial advisor who can provide guidance and help you make an informed decision.
